you say "And also we are not going to be able to allow CME Group historical data to be accessed through the DTC protocol server:
https://www.sierrachart.com/index.php?page=doc/DTCServer.php"
I'm currently using my own DTC Client to get historical and real-time data for stocks, and I'm about ready to use it for CME symbols like MES and MNQ.
1. Is this really going to be prohibited? Both my DTC client and Sierra Chart are running on the same machine, so I'm surprised CME could object.
2. Does it really apply only to historical data and not real-time data?
3. If I cannot connect through DTC, what will be my alternative? Trading via DTC through Sierra Chart and using someone like IQ Feed for data?
4. Will this also be disallowed with your new CME Direct routing?

1. Absolutely yes. We must follow any requests from exchanges.

2. It probably will apply to real-time data too at some point.

3. Have a look at ACSIL and see if you can accomplish what you need using that:
Advanced Custom Study Interface and Language (ACSIL)

4. Yes.
